Continental Airlines Starts Greenbrier, Cleveland Flights

Continental Airlines has started flights from Greenbrier Valley Airport (Web site: www.gvairport.com) to Cleveland Hopkins International Airport.

The new flights, which started in September, operate twice daily, and unlike Delta Air Lines’ services which operate between April and November, the Continental flights will operate year round.

Continental has also eliminated its services between Charleston and Cleveland.
